Arrow The 2005 WWE Draft Lottery - Official Thread

2005 WWE Draft Lottery
June 13th, 2005


The 2005 Draft Lottery is now over. Throughout the month of June, both WWE rosters were hit with monumental changes, starting with the WWE Champion get picked to compete on RAW and ending with the World Heavyweight Champion moving to SmackDown! Below are the full results of the 2005 WWE Draft Lottery.

June 6th: RAW drafts John Cena
June 9th: SmackDown! drafts Chris Benoit

June 13th: RAW drafts Kurt Angle
June 16th: SmackDown! drafts Randy Orton

June 20th: RAW drafts Carlito
June 23rd: SmackDown! drafts Muhammad Hassan
June 27th: RAW drafts Big Show & Rob Van Dam
June 30th: SmackDown! drafts Christian & Batista

Keep in mind that all picks in the 2005 WWE Draft Lottery were drawn at random. RAW drew from the SmackDown! roster of Superstars. SmackDown! drew from the RAW roster of Superstars.

All RAW and SmackDown! Superstars were eligible to be drafted, including champions, Divas, announcers and even General Managers.

Additionally, General Managers were allowed to trade Superstars up until Midnight on June 30th. Click here to view the 11-person trade that went down.

RAW and SmackDown! agree to 11-person deal
June 30th, 2005




WWE.com has learned that RAW General Manager Eric Bischoff and SmackDown! General Manager Theodore Long have agreed on a blockbuster 11-person deal that will likely have a big impact on both rosters.

RAW brand gets:

Mark Jindrak: Former WCW Tag Team Champion
Rene Dupree: Former WWE Tag Team Champion; former World Tag Team Champion
Danny Basham: Two-time former WWE Tag Team Champion
Kenzo Suzuki (with Hiroko): Former WWE Tag Team Champion
Chavo Guerrero: Five-time former Cruiserweight Champion; two-time former WWE Tag Team Champion

SmackDown! brand gets:

William Regal: Four-time former WCW Television Champion; three-time former Hardcore Champion; four-time former European Champion; former Intercontinental Champion; four-time former World Tag Team Champion
Candice: 2004 RAW Diva Search contestant
Sylvain Grenier: Four-time former World Tag Team Champion
Simon Dean: Former RAW sponsor
Steven Richards: Former two-time ECW Tag Team Champion; former 21-time Hardcore Champion
